• 欢迎使用千万蜘蛛池,网站外链优化,蜘蛛池引蜘蛛快速提高网站收录,收藏快捷键 CTRL + D

什么是MemSQL?恒讯科技全方位介绍


MemSQL是一种高性能、可扩展的分布式内存数据库管理系统,它的开发初衷是为了处理大规模数据和实现实时数据分析。相比传统磁盘存储数据库,MemSQL采用内存存储和分布式架构,具有更快的响应时间和更高的性能。本文将对MemSQL进行全方面介绍,包括MemSQL的特点、主要特性、应用场景等,帮助读者更全面了解这一领域的技术。

MemSQL简介

MemSQL是一种分布式内存数据库管理系统,结合了传统关系型数据库和NoSQL数据库的优点,提供了高性能、易用性和可扩展性等特点。MemSQL采用内存优先的设计,将数据存储在内存中,以实现高速访问和处理;采用分布式架构,可以将数据分布在多个节点上,以提高性能和可靠性。同时,MemSQL还支持实时数据分析,并通过标准的SQL查询支持迁移和应用开发。

MemSQL的特点

MemSQL在设计上具有以下几个特点:

特点 描述
分布式 MemSQL可以分布在多个节点上,以提高性能和可靠性。
内存优先 MemSQL将数据存储在内存中,以实现高速访问和处理。
实时分析 MemSQL支持实时数据分析,无需等待数据加载到磁盘。
SQL兼容性 MemSQL支持标准的SQL查询,使得迁移和应用开发更加容易。

从表格可以看出,MemSQL主要特点包括分布式、内存优先、实时分析和SQL兼容性。

MemSQL的主要特性

高性能

MemSQL的设计目标是提供高性能的数据访问和处理,通过使用内存存储和分布式架构,MemSQL可以提供比传统磁盘存储数据库更快的响应时间。内存存储可以极大地提高数据的访问速度,而分布式架构则可以实现不断扩容和负载均衡。

可扩展性

MemSQL的分布式架构使其能够轻松地扩展以处理更大的数据量,你可以通过添加更多的节点来增加存储容量和计算能力。在数据量特别大的情况下,MemSQL可以将数据缓存到磁盘,以节省内存资源。

实时分析

MemSQL支持实时数据分析,这意味着你可以在数据到达时立即对其进行查询和分析,而无需等待数据被写入磁盘。这种实时性对于需要快速响应的应用场景非常重要,例如金融领域,数据的实时性可以大大加快风险决策。

SQL兼容性

MemSQL支持标准的SQL查询,这使得从其他数据库迁移到MemSQL变得相对容易,这也意味着你可以使用你已经熟悉的SQL工具和技能来操作MemSQL。这种兼容性可以降低操作难度,加快应用开发的速度。

MemSQL的应用场景

MemSQL适用于需要快速、实时数据分析的应用,例如金融交易、广告技术、物联网等。它的高性能和可扩展性使其成为处理大规模数据集的理想选择。

归纳

本文对分布式内存数据库管理系统MemSQL进行了全方面介绍,包括MemSQL的特点、主要特性和应用场景。可以看出,MemSQL结合了传统关系型数据库和NoSQL数据库的优点,提供了高性能、易用性和可扩展性等特点。无论是需要处理大规模数据还是需要实时数据分析,在MemSQL的支持下,都能得到更好的解决。

相关问题推荐

1. MemSQL可以和哪些其他数据库联合使用?

2. MemSQL的性能如何保证?

3. MemSQL适合哪些类型的应用场景?

4. 如何使用MemSQL进行数据迁移?

欢迎在评论区留下你对MemSQL的看法和经验,也欢迎关注我们的公众号(xxxx),获取更多科技前沿资讯和技术文章。

感谢您的阅读,谢谢!

恒讯科技全方位介绍:什么是MemSQL?(图片来源网络,侵删) 恒讯科技全方位介绍:什么是MemSQL?(图片来源网络,侵删)

本文链接:https://www.24zzc.com/news/171733510078006.html

蜘蛛工具

  • 中文转拼音工具
  • WEB标准颜色卡
  • 域名筛选工具